Moving FAQs for SeaTac

1) Are you a mover or a broker?
Puget Sound Moving serves SeaTac as a real moving company, not a broker. Your crew, truck, and schedule are handled directly by our team—no broker handoffs, no third parties, and no last-minute substitutions. Whether you’re moving near Angle Lake or into communities around Midway and North SeaTac, your move stays fully in-house.

2) What’s the best time to move in SeaTac?
Mid-week mornings are usually best, especially before traffic builds on International Boulevard (Pacific Highway S), SR-518, and the I-5/I-405 connector flow nearby. We also plan around congestion near Seattle–Tacoma International Airport, the SeaTac/Airport Station area, and busy hotel corridors along International Boulevard.

3) Do you do same-building or short-distance moves?
Yes. Short moves are common in apartment communities near Angle Lake Station, around S 200th Street, and along International Boulevard. We stage items by zone, coordinate elevator reservations, and plan truck placement carefully in tighter parking lots common near airport-area buildings.

4) Can you handle walk-up apartments and tight stairs?
Absolutely. SeaTac has many stair-only complexes and tight stairwells, especially along Pacific Highway S and in older properties near S 176th Street. We bring stair straps, corner guards, and door-frame protection, and we size the crew to keep momentum without rushing.

5) How do you protect my home and common areas?
We use clean moving blankets, stretch wrap, floor runners, and padding for rails and corners. In SeaTac condos and managed buildings near Angle Lake, Bow Lake Park, and airport-adjacent properties, we follow building rules to keep hallways, stairwells, and elevators clean.

6) What items need special handling?
Pianos, safes, art, glass, and oversized sectionals require extra planning. We confirm measurements, tight turns, and truck placement—especially where parking is limited near International Boulevard, or in properties with narrow access lanes around S 200th Street and 24th Avenue S.

7) Do you disassemble and reassemble furniture?
Yes. Standard beds, tables, desks, and modular furniture are disassembled and reassembled as part of the move. For specialty or custom-built pieces, we’ll advise ahead of time so we can plan tools, hardware management, and protection.

8) Do you assist with packing for SeaTac moves?
Yes. We offer full or partial packing across SeaTac, from apartments near Angle Lake Station to homes near North SeaTac Park and the communities around Des Moines Memorial Drive S. We bring sturdy boxes, labeling systems, and rain-ready protection so items arrive organized and secure.

9) What should I do before the crew arrives?
Set aside valuables, label boxes by room, and share access details like gate codes, call boxes, or parking instructions. In airport-adjacent areas with strict parking and loading rules—especially along International Boulevard and S 176th Street—curb and loading info helps us plan faster setups.
